Description Strategic Imperative Chargie is a leading provider of intelligent, intuitive, and reliable electric vehicle charging solutions for modern commercial buildings, multifamily communities, and the growing number of EV drivers. Our vision is to create infrastructure that powers communities in the all-electric future. We are seeking a motivated and detail-oriented Warehouse Technician to support our installation initiatives. About the Role The Warehouse Technician, alongside the Warehouse Manager, supports daily warehouse operations, including receiving, storing, picking, packing, and shipping equipment used to install EV charging stations. This includes EV chargers, electrical switchgear, networking equipment, conduit, breakers, and other electrical components. The role is responsible for keeping inventory accurate, handling equipment safely, and making sure the right materials are ready when crews need them. This position takes pride in doing solid, detail-oriented work that directly supports clean transportation and real-world environmental impact. Key Responsibilities Warehouse Operations Receive, inspect, and log incoming shipments for accuracy and damage Pick, pack, kit, and ship materials according to sales orders to meet install schedules Issue installation kits to internal installation teams and subcontractors when scheduled Assist with delivery of installation kits, where appropriate Label, stage, and store inventory in designated warehouse locations Maintain a clean, safe, and organized warehouse floor at all times Inventory & Systems Perform cycle counts and assist with full physical inventory counts Accurately record inventory movements in inventory management systems (e.g., ERP or WMS) Investigate and resolve inventory discrepancies Support inventory audits and reconciliation efforts Equipment & Material Handling Safely operate warehouse equipment such as pallet jacks and hand trucks (forklift preferred if applicable) Handle components and equipment with care to prevent damage Prepare outbound shipments, including packing, documentation, and carrier coordination Cross-Functional Support Coordinate with Operations, Procurement, Field Teams, and Technical Project Managers on material needs Collaborate with Finance / Accounting teams on inventory reconciliation, inquiries regarding material allocation and receiving Support urgent requests and priority fulfillment when required Assist with kitting or prefabrication of chargers / equipment as needed Provide feedback towards product evaluations as requested for Strategic Sourcing Requirements Qualifications The Must Haves High school diploma or equivalent 1–3 years of warehouse, logistics, or inventory experience Basic computer skills (email, spreadsheets) Strong attention to detail and accuracy Ability to lift up to 50 lbs and perform physical warehouse tasks Ability to follow safety procedures and standard operating processes Must be available to work onsite at the Culver City warehouse from 7:00AM to 4:00PM The Nice to Haves Experience with ERP or inventory systems (NetSuite, SAP, Oracle, etc.) Forklift certification or willingness to obtain Experience with cycle counts and inventory audits Previous experience in technical, equipment-based, or project-driven warehouses Key Skills & Competencies Organizational and time management skills Problem solving and discrepancy investigation Strong communication and teamwork Reliability and accountability Safety first mindset Ability to process, scan, and digitally organize paperwork using structured file - management systems (e.g., attaching documents in ERP system or maintaining organized folder structures by vendor or purchase order) Why Join Us?
